Feds charge alleged Bay Area Norteño ‘shot caller’ with possessing guns in secret car compartment

SAN FRANCISCO — Federal prosecutors right here have charged an alleged “shot caller” within the Mission District’s Norteño gang with possessing two pistols present in a hidden compartment of his Ford F-150 pickup truck, courtroom information present.

Nicholas Addleman, of San Francisco, was charged in December with being a felon in possession of a firearm and ammunition, which carries a 15-year federal jail time period if he's convicted on these fees. U.S. Justice of the Peace Choose Lisa Cisneros launched Addleman to a midway home whereas the case is pending, courtroom information present.

In a failed bid to maintain Addleman behind bars, federal prosecutors described him as a high-ranking gang member who served as a “shot caller” throughout a five-year stint on the county jail, the place he was positioned in administrative segregation for allegedly ordering an assault in late 2021. Prosecutors additionally allege that Addleman shot an individual within the face at an Oracle Park stadium car parking zone in 2017. The sufferer ended up with a bullet lodged of their head and “miraculously survived,” authorities mentioned.

Addleman was on parole in October 2022, when San Francisco officers pulled him over on Judah Road and searched his truck. Two loaded semi-automatic pistols have been present in a hidden compartment within the middle console of the truck, and later linked to Addleman by means of a DNA search, in keeping with the felony criticism.

After his arrest, Addleman allegedly requested his spouse if his sister “took every little thing” out of the home and requested her to retrieve one thing from the truck that police apparently failed to search out, in keeping with the prosecution movement. In addition they mentioned “one other Norteño gang member” and knowledge “a few suspected informant,” prosecutors wrote.

Cisneros granted a current movement to permit Addleman to depart the midway home for a Christmas celebration. He's subsequent due in courtroom for a standing convention on Wednesday.
